About Dancemakers
Dancemakers is a contemporary dance creation centre programming residencies, performances, workshops, and ancillary activities to support the development of the field of contemporary dance in Canada. Dancemakers programs long-term fully resourced residencies for a rotating roster of local, national, and international artists, developing a cohort of artists and a body of work that is consistently shifting and in development. Through an overarching vision developed by Curator Amelia Ehrhardt, Dancemakers animates a space where contemporary dance creation, presentation, and development provoke unexpected discoveries, sensations, and meanings. Dancemakers’ home is The Centre for Creation, in Toronto's Distillery Historic District.
